Position: Managing Director, Institutional Partnerships

The client is seeking a Managing Director of Institutional Partnerships to lead efforts in securing external funding for policy research,

advocacy

, and programmatic work among institutional funders. Reporting to the Chief Development Officer, this role involves developing and implementing an institutional giving strategy to increase foundation and corporate revenue while building partnerships to achieve programmatic goals. The Managing Director will provide vision for the fundraising team, collaborate with research and program divisions, and oversee the acquisition and stewardship of financial resources to advance the clients mission.

This

senior leadership

position requires a

dynamic

and strategic individual who can drive the clients fundraising efforts forward. The Managing Director will work closely with the executive office to ensure alignment with organizational goals and objectives. With the opportunity to co-lead the development team of a well-established organization embarking on an ambitious campaign, the MD will play a crucial role in expanding the clients impact and reach through effective partnership-building and resource acquisition.

Overall, the Managing Director of Institutional Partnerships will be responsible for leading and expanding the clients institutional funding efforts. By providing direction for the fundraising team, collaborating with research and program divisions, and securing financial resources, the MD will drive the clients mission forward and contribute to its growth and success in the policy
